Q: Is 1,674,394 a Prime Number?
A: No, 1,674,394 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 1674394 can be evenly divided by 1 2 19 38 139 278 317 634 2,641 5,282 6,023 12,046 44,063 88,126 837,197 and 1,674,394, with no remainder.
Since 1,674,394 cannot be divided by just 1 and 1,674,394, it is not a prime number.
